Udinese Chase Saint-Etiene Defender Yohan Benalouane - Report
Italians are quick to search for Lukovic cover....
By Andrew McLean
Udinese are interested in the acquisition of Saint-Etienne defender Yohan Benalouane, according to BBC Sport. The Serie A club yesterday confirmed the sale of Serbian Aleksandar Lukovic to Zenit St. Petersburg and are already looking at the 23-year-old Frenchman to re-shape their backline.
The defender broke into the first team in Ligue 1 in 2007 and as of last season has been ever present, making 64 league appearances in total for Saint-Etienne. Newcastle United have also been eager to sign the centre-back, who has one year left on his contract, but he has already told his club he does not intend to re-sign. With Newcastle having signed experienced centre-back Sol Campbell this week, it could leave the door open for Udinese to snap up the wantaway youngster.
In the meantime the Bianconeri are also continuing their pursuit of Ternana attacker Luis Jimenez. The Chilean has been on loan for the majority of the last four years with Lazio, Inter, West Ham and Parma.
